Harold’s Fish and Chicken Plans Spring Opening On Winchester Road

The location will feature fried chicken, fish and shrimp in the previous site of the old Baymon's fish market.

The owner of the new eatery, Brandon Griffin, told What Now Memphis that his latest restaurant will feature fried chicken, fish and shrimp.

Griffin hopes for a May opening of Harold’s Fish and Chicken at 5181 Winchester Road in Memphis, following all necessary licenses and inspections. He also hopes to eventually apply for a beer and wine permit. For now, Harold’s will be a mostly grab-and-go location, with room for about 12 people to sit and dine. 

This is Griffin’s fourth restaurant in the area. He had to put in a new vent hood in the kitchen, which he said was a “very big project.”

The location used to house Baymon’s Fresh Fish Market, which closed following the death of the owner, according to Griffin.

“He was one of my customers at another restaurant that I had, and that’s how I met him,” Griffin said. “That goes to show hour good our fish was.”
